In your first session, your tutor will learn about your college goals, review any essay prompts you're working with, and assess where you need the most support—whether that's brainstorming, drafting, or polishing. From there, you'll work together through multiple revisions, receiving personalized feedback on everything from argument development to sentence-level writing.

Many students struggle with writer's block when facing a blank page, or they write essays that feel generic rather than personal. Others have difficulty organizing their thoughts coherently, developing a compelling thesis, or striking the right balance between showing personality and maintaining a professional tone. Additionally, students often underestimate how much revision is needed—strong essays typically go through multiple drafts with targeted feedback.

Revision is essential—most admissions officers can tell the difference between a first draft and a polished essay. Working with a tutor gives you access to an experienced reader who can identify where your argument needs strengthening, where your voice shines through, and where unclear phrasing might confuse readers. This personalized feedback accelerates the revision process and helps you produce an essay you're genuinely proud to submit.

Absolutely. One of the biggest mistakes students make is trying to sound like what they think admissions officers want to hear, which often results in stiff, impersonal writing. Tutors help you find and strengthen your authentic voice by encouraging you to write naturally, share genuine experiences, and let your personality come through. The result is an essay that feels distinctly yours and stands out from thousands of similar applications.

Bring any college essay prompts you've received, along with any drafts you've already started—even rough, incomplete versions are helpful. If you haven't started writing yet, bring notes on potential topics or experiences you're considering. It's also useful to have information about the colleges you're applying to and any specific requirements or word limits. Your tutor will use this to create a personalized plan for your sessions.

The timeline depends on where you're starting and how many essays you need to write. If you're beginning from scratch, most students benefit from starting 2-3 months before their application deadline. If you already have a draft, even a few sessions focused on revision and refinement can make a significant difference. Your tutor can help you create a realistic timeline based on your specific needs and deadlines.
